Water Damage Reconstruction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small leak under a sink | Yes | No | It’s easy to fix. But if you miss the source, it can worsen. |
| Water on the floor from a pipe burst | No | Yes | It’s a big job. You need the right tools and know-how. |
| Standing water in a room | No | Yes | It’s dangerous and can cause mold quickly. Professionals handle it safely. |
| Water damage from a flood | No | Yes | It’s a major problem. You need a full assessment and restoration plan. |
| Water in the walls | No | Yes | It’s not visible but it’s serious. You need experts to find and fix it. |
| Water damage that’s been there a week | No | Yes | Time is against you. Mold and structural damage can happen fast. |

Water Damage Reconstruction Cost In Afton, VA
Costs vary based on the size of the job and the extent of the damage. You can expect to pay between $500 and $2,500 for smaller jobs. Larger projects can range from $3,000 to $10,000 or more. The final price depends on the source of the water, how long it was there, and the materials affected. These are estimates. Exact costs will be clear after an on-site evaluation.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ction | $500 – $1,500 | Amount of water and access to the area. |
| Drying and dehumidification | $500 – $2,500 | Size of the space and how long it takes to dry. |
| Wall repair | $300 – $1,200 | Damage level and materials used. |
| Floor repair | $400 – $1,500 | Type of flooring and extent of damage. |
| Mold remediation | $600 – $3,000 | Size of the affected area and type of mold. |
| Full reconstruction | $2,000 – $10,000+ | Overall damage and materials needed. |
